Hidden Home Vermin



Are you familiar with the hidden home insects that may be prowling in your home? While you may be vigilant about common pests like ants or spiders, there are other sneaky burglars that could be creating damage behind the scenes.



One such insect is the silverfish, a small bug that grows in moist and dark environments like cellars and washrooms. These insects can harm books, clothing, and also wallpaper, making them a problem to take care of.

An additional surprise parasite to keep an eye out for is the carpeting beetle. These small insects feed on a selection of materials discovered in homes, such as carpets, clothing, and upholstery. Their larvae can trigger considerable damage if left unattended, making it vital to attend to any kind of signs of infestation promptly.

Additionally, mold and mildew mites are commonly neglected but can show a wetness problem in your house. These little animals feed on mold and can worsen allergic reactions for delicate people. Maintaining your home completely dry and well-ventilated can assist avoid these parasites from settling in your home.

Sneaky Home Invaders



While you might be diligent in maintaining your home clean and arranged, sneaky home invaders can still locate their way in unnoticed. These parasites are masters of hiding in plain sight, making it important to stay alert in spotting their existence.

Below are a couple of sneaky home invaders you should look out for:

1. ** Silverfish **: These little, silvery pests enjoy damp, dark rooms like basements and shower rooms. They eat starchy materials and can create damages to books, wallpaper, and clothes.

2. ** Rug Beetles **: Usually incorrect for harmless ladybugs, rug beetles can ruin your home. Their larvae eat all-natural fibers like woollen and silk, triggering irreversible damage to carpetings, apparel, and upholstery.

3. ** Earwigs **: Despite their ominous-looking pincers, earwigs are even more of a problem than a danger. They're attracted to dampness and can discover their method right into your home through cracks and crevices. Keep an eye out for them in moist locations like kitchens and bathrooms.
